Advantages And Disadvantages Of Using A Solid Waste Incinerator

A solid waste incinerator is a facility used to burn solid waste for the purpose of reducing its volume and converting it into energy. This process helps in managing waste effectively and reducing the amount of waste that ends up in landfills. solid waste incinerators have been used for decades as a method of waste disposal, but they are not without controversy.

There are several advantages to using a solid waste incinerator as a method of waste management. One of the main benefits is the reduction in the volume of waste. By burning solid waste, the volume of waste is reduced by up to 90%, which helps in saving space in landfills. This is important as landfills are filling up quickly and are becoming a scarce resource.

Another advantage of using a solid waste incinerator is the production of energy. The heat generated from burning solid waste can be used to produce electricity or heat water, which can then be used for various purposes. This helps in reducing the dependency on fossil fuels and contributes to a more sustainable energy future.

solid waste incinerators also help in reducing greenhouse gas emissions. When organic waste decomposes in landfills, it produces methane, which is a potent greenhouse gas. By burning solid waste in incinerators, the methane emissions are reduced, thus helping in combating climate change.

Moreover, solid waste incinerators can be more cost-effective than other waste management methods. While the initial cost of building an incinerator may be high, the long-term cost of operating and maintaining it can be lower than continuously managing waste in landfills. This can result in cost savings for municipalities and taxpayers in the long run.

However, there are also several disadvantages to using a solid waste incinerator. One of the main concerns is air pollution. Burning solid waste releases pollutants such as dioxins, heavy metals, and particulate matter into the air, which can have negative impacts on human health and the environment. To mitigate this issue, incinerators must be equipped with advanced emission control technologies.

Another disadvantage of solid waste incinerators is the potential for toxic ash residue. After the waste is burned, the remaining ash contains toxic chemicals that can contaminate soil and water if not managed properly. Proper disposal and treatment of ash residue are essential to prevent environmental contamination.

Community opposition is another challenge faced by solid waste incinerators. Many people are concerned about the health risks associated with living near an incinerator, as well as the potential for odors and noise pollution. Public perception of incinerators can lead to political resistance and regulatory hurdles, making it difficult to implement these facilities in certain areas.
